Private Pilot

The Private Pilot certificate is the kind of certification that most student pilots first seek and receive when they begin their career as a Professional Pilot in Aviation. Whether you want to fly for pleasure, or for business use, or because you want to start a career as a Commercial Pilot. This is the certification with which it begins.

Requirements

  • Be at least 16 years old to fly solo.
  • Be at least 17 years old to receive your private pilot certificate.
  • Obtain at least a third-class medical certificate.
  • Pass a written knowledge exam.
  • Pass a final practical exam.

Ground School (Pilot Knowledge Test)

Students who enroll in this ground school course, will be completing the most important part of the requirements needed to obtain the FAA Private Pilot Certificate. This aeronautical knowledge exam focuses mainly on what applicants must know.

This 58-hour course, which includes flight simulation practice in ATD’s training devises among other resources like videos and stage practice tests, is to prepare the student to take the FAA Private Pilot written knowledge test.

A satisfactorily completed knowledge test expires 24 calendar-months after the month it was taken. We highly recommend, right after accomplishing the goal of passing the knowledge test, you should persevere towards your license by starting your flight training, which is the aeronautical experience. Within this 24-month period, you must complete your flight time requirements and pass the practical test. Flight Training (Pilot Practical Exam)

After finishing the gound school course, and passing the written knowledge test, you may begin flight training using actual airplanes. So, you need to receive flight instruction from a Certified Flight Instructor (CFI). The FAA requires 40 hours of actual flight training to earn a Private Pilot License. This includes completing your first solo flight, day and night flying, cross-country and other types of flight training requirements. These skills can be supplemented in a flight simulator.

Once your Flight Instructor feels you are ready, he or she will arrange the final practical test with an FAA Examiner. The practical exam focuses on what applicants must consider (risk) and do (skill). When the practical test is passed, you are now an official Private Pilot.
